Output de314dffaf90f179d36c26a16689d6e438197197156b0beabd4cbf87375f7518:1

value
31918000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17119e238ce99da19e537edc96310bf6e6545a1c OP_EQUAL
address
9tYFJuLYLUth4fUQ2XkCoDPXGWR18tM5ED
transaction
de314dffaf90f179d36c26a16689d6e438197197156b0beabd4cbf87375f7518